Transaction 577dc85e6bcf59cb590a9f47204dd1358756a6e40fb386f5064989e1e88175b2
1 Input
1 Output
-
577dc85e6bcf59cb590a9f47204dd1358756a6e40fb386f5064989e1e88175b2:0
- value
- 28375158
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 213af16b4c8925b05728f68d6af6b92e0d3a42d3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 142humN1BQioYgJ7Jx7LeWFZYnCtJrFX1z